New email worm "Bagle" on the loose

A new Internet worm has been noted to be spreading fast throughout the internet, with home users at greatest risk.

The 'Bagle' or 'Beagle' worm arrives as an e-mail with the subject 'hi' and the word 'test' in the message body. If the accompanying attachment is executed, the worm attempts to send itself to all e-mail addresses listed in the user's address book.

An Associated Press report also quoted Mr David Perry, spokesman for anti-virus software firm Trend Micro Inc, as saying ,"Sometimes the attachment is designed to look like a Microsoft calculator."

The virus is known to affect only machines running on Microsoft Windows operating systems.
